Lash Adhesive 101: Everything You Need to Know

The longevity of eyelash extensions is a delicate balance of glue quality, application technique, and aftercare. This guide will walk you through the essential steps to ensure your eyelash glue performs optimally, enhancing both the quality and durability of your extensions.

Optimal Conditions for Glue Usage


  • 1. Temperature:
    Maintain a temperature between 18°C and 25°C (64°F and 77°F). This range ensures the glue's viscosity is ideal for application, preventing it from drying too quickly or too slowly.

  • 2. Humidity:
    A humidity level between 50% and 65% is recommended. This range helps the glue cure properly, ensuring strong adhesion without becoming too brittle or weak.

  • 3. Avoid Drafts:
    Keep the glue away from direct drafts or air conditioning vents. Sudden changes in temperature and humidity can affect the glue's performance.

  • Storage Tips for Unused Glue

  • 1. Cool and Dark:
    Store unopened glue in a cool, dark place, away from direct sunlight. This helps preserve the glue's quality and shelf life.

  • 2. Refrigeration:
    For areas with high temperatures, consider storing the glue in a professional beauty refrigerator set below 12°C (54°F). However, avoid using a household refrigerator due to the risk of moisture contamination.

  • 3. Seal Properly:
    Always ensure the glue bottle is tightly sealed after use to prevent moisture from entering and degrading the adhesive.

  • Preparing the Glue for Application

  • 1. Temperature Control:
    Keep the room temperature between 18°C and 25°C (64°F and 77°F) during application. Extreme temperatures can affect the glue's performance.

  • 2. Humidity Control:
    A humidity level of 55% is optimal. If the humidity is too high (above 65%), the glue may cure too quickly and become brittle. If it's too low, the curing process slows down, potentially leading to weaker bonds.

  • 3. Activation:
    Before using the glue, shake the bottle vigorously for more than 30 seconds. This ensures the glue is well-mixed and ready for application.

  • 4. Check Consistency:
    After shaking, check the glue's consistency. It should flow out as a liquid black color, indicating it's ready for use.

  • 5. Air Release:
    Tilt the bottle at a 45° angle and squeeze out any air before sealing it. This prevents air bubbles that can affect the glue's performance.

  • 6. Clean Nozzle:
    Wipe the nozzle clean with a lint-free cotton pad after each use to ensure a smooth flow of glue.

  • 7. Desiccant Packet:
    Store the glue with a desiccant packet to absorb any moisture that may enter the bottle.
